Being the science geek that I am, I enjoy reading about science from a historical aspect. I stumbled upon a Web site today that combines the archives of Modern Mechanics, Popular Mechanics, Popular Science, and Scientific American.

Some of the articles are quite intriguing, such as the one from 1938 describing the home experiments you can do with hydrofluoric acid. Yes, that's the same acid that eats through glass.
So much for the modern disclaimer: "kids, don't try this at home..."
